What is SASE?
SASE stands for Secure Access Service Edge. It's a cloud-based architecture that combines networking and security functions. SASE helps organizations improve their network security by delivering it as a service, directly from the cloud.
What is OpenID Connect?
OpenID Connect is a simple identity layer on top of the OAuth 2.0 protocol. It allows applications to confirm the identity of end-users based on the authentication performed by an authorization server.
